薄煤层综采工作面末采区域柔性网护顶技术研究与应用  被引量:2

Research and Application of Flexible Net Roof Protection Technology in Final Mining Area of Fully Mechanized Coal Face in Thin Coal Seam

摘  要:为保障2201工作面回撤区域顶板和回撤通道围岩的稳定,通过分析柔性网护顶技术原理及施工工艺,结合工作面末采区域的具体特征,进行柔性网护顶技术方案中钢丝绳、网片、锚杆索及拖网锚杆等参数的设计,并对回撤通道的施工方式及锚网索支护参数进行设计。根据工作面回撤期间的现场观测结果可知,工作面在现有柔性网护顶和回撤通道支护方案下,回撤期间顶板无大范围漏冒现象,回撤通道围岩处于稳定状态,工作面顺利进行了回撤作业。In order to ensure the stability of the roof and the surrounding rock of the withdrawal channel in the 2201 working face,through the analysis of the technical principle and construction technology of the flexible mesh roof protection,combined with the specific characteristics of the final mining area of the working face,the parameters such as wire rope,mesh,anchor cable and trawl anchor in the flexible mesh roof protection technical scheme are designed,and the construction mode of the withdrawal channel and the anchor mesh cable support parameters are designed.According to the on-site observation results during the withdrawal period of the working face,under the existing flexible mesh roof protection and withdrawal channel support scheme,there is no large-scale leakage phenomenon of the roof during the withdrawal period,the surrounding rock of the withdrawal channel is in a stable state,and the withdrawal operation was carried out smoothly in the working face.

关 键 词:综采 末采 柔性网
